The Objective of Probate Bonds



Probate bonds act as a crucial financial protection system for executors and managers overseeing the distribution of an estate. As an administrator or administrator, you have the duty to manage the assets and financial obligations of the departed individual's estate. The probate bond, additionally called an executor bond or fiduciary bond, guarantees that you satisfy your duties ethically and legally.

By requiring a probate bond, the court intends to secure the estate from any kind of prospective mismanagement or misconduct on your part. If you, as the executor or administrator, act dishonestly or negligently, the bond supplies a type of insurance coverage to compensate the beneficiaries of the estate for any kind of monetary losses incurred. This protection is essential in cases where the executor makes mistakes in managing the estate's possessions or falls short to comply with the legal demands of the probate process.

Ultimately, probate bonds use peace of mind to the recipients of the estate, as they offer a layer of monetary safety and security against the dangers related to estate management.
